comparemela.com
Home
Dausa One Computerised
Top Dausa One Computerised | Reviews & Ratings | comparemela.com
Dausa one computerised in India - 303303/ near dausa/ near dausa
1.A One Computerised Diagnostic Digital XRAY Centre Dausa